Fuchsia is a genus of flowering plants that consists mostly of shrubs or small trees. The first, Fuchsia triphylla, was discovered on the Caribbean island of Hispaniola about 1696–1697 by the French Minim monk and botanist, Charles Plumier during his third expedition to the Greater Antilles. He named the new genus after the renowned German botanist Leonhart Fuchs (1501–1566). Source
'Fountain Gardens' was a garden
promenade attraction on western Sentosa Island in Singapore which opened in
1989. It was located in the Imbiah Lookout entertainment zone. The gardens and
other features were demolished in 2007 for construction of the new Resorts
World Sentosa, a large integrated style resort with new entertainment venues. The
'Fountain Gardens' promenade terminus was at the entry gates of the former Sentosa
Musical Fountain feature, a very large musical fountain grouping of coordinated
individual jets and pools. Source
